What happend at the Lincoln Douglas debates
DIA [1.3K]

Answer:

Lincoln-Douglas debates, series of seven debates between the Democratic senator Stephen A. Douglas and Republican challenger Abraham Lincoln during the 1858 Illinois senatorial campaign, largely concerning the issue of slavery extension into the territories.

Anti-Federalists argued that
trapecia [35]
The Anti-Federalists argued that the Constitution gave too much power to the federal government, and less power to the states.
